Romania - Sold Production of Heat Exchange Units
Since 2014, Romania Sold Production of Heat Exchange Units grew 0.9%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 17 comparing other countries in Sold Production of Heat Exchange Units with €18,652,840.76. Romania is overtaken by Serbia, which was number 16 with €23,865,013.03 and is followed by Norway with €8,848,460.51. Italy lead the ranking with €1,460,269,921.88 in 2019, that is +8.5% versus 2018. Germany, France and Sweden resp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Greece recorded the best 5 years average growth at +37.3% per year, while Estonia was the worst growing country at -53.5% per year.
